Linus Torvalds wrote: > One thing that _might_ be a good idea for tags (if people _really_ want to > actually update tags under the same name) is to have a "parent" pointer > for tag objects, the same way we have for commits. That way you could - if > you really wanted to - create a chain of tags, and show the history of > them. Wouldn't it be better to just use reflog for given tag?
